The Aquaporins Gene MRNA Expression Diversity After Weaning In Difference Tissue Of Piglets Using SYBR Realtime PCR

Aquaporins (AQPs) was one kind of the membrane channel proteins which could transport water molecules selectively and efficiently. The study showed that AQPs expressed abundantly in intestinal epithelial cells, and AQPs was involved in the secretion of intestinal mucus. The piglet's diarrhea was the most common, harmful problem for the early weaned piglets, which induced with the super-early-weaned piglets (SEW) technology. Therefore, making the role of AQPs in the pathogenesis of weaned piglets diarrhea, appears very important, which could provide theoretical basis for the clinic treatment, improve treatment technology and means.In this paper, took pig as object of study, designed primers according to the cloning principle of homologous sequence, cloned pig Aqp2-11 gene by RT-PCR, and then run bioinformatics analysis. The expression level of nine housekeeping gene ACTB,B2M,GAPDH,HMBS,HPRT1,RPL4,SDHA,TBP1 and YWHAZ mRNA was detected in different tissues of piglets by real-time fluorescence quantitative PCR technology, identified the best gene to calibrate target gene expression in different tissues of piglets. Then selected the gene Aqp1, 3, 7, 8, 10 and 11 of pig, and the diversity of mRNA expression was detected by real-time fluorescence quantitative PCR before and after weaning, and the results showed that:1) The cloned AQPs gene family include Aqp2, Aqp3, Aqp4, Aqp5, Aqp6, Aqp7, Aqp8, Aqp9, Aqp10 and Aqp11, and the corresponding NCBI accession number are EU636238, EU161094, EU165525, EU192130, EU620575, EU024116, EU220426, EU220427, EU582021 and EU220425. Sequence analysis showed that: the selectable permeability of pig AQPs gene family comply with a standard of the four sub-family classification.2) The expression stability of the housekeeping gene was: HMBS and HPRT1> RPL4> TBP1> B2M1> YWHAZ> SDHA> GAPDH> ACTB, which identified that the HMBS gene was the best choice to calibrate target gene expression in different tissues of piglets, and RPL4 gene could be taken as the internal gene of the high transcripts. 3) After the piglet was weaned, the expression of pig AQP1, AQP3, AQP7, AQP8, AQP10 and AQP11 generally increase in the digestive tract. And the expression of AQP8 in the gastric tissue after weaning significantly increase.
